Gender refers to the characteristics of women, men, girls and boys that are socially constructed. This includes norms, behaviours and roles associated with being a woman, man, girl or boy, as well as relationships with each other. As a social construct, gender varies from society to society and can change over time.” World Health Organisation, 2023

Gender refers to the social and cultural identity of a person based on the societal norms and expectations associated with being male, female, or another gender identity. It can also refer to the biological differences between males and females, such as reproductive organs and chromosomes. However, it’s important to understand that gender is not determined solely by biology and can vary from culture to culture.
